Lined with traditional Balinese-style cottages that come with private gardens and pools as well as a serene golf course, gym and ethereal riverside spa, this resort is an extension of Ubud s prime attractions such as the Sacred Monkey Forest Sanctuary, Goa Gajah Cave Temple and Tegallalang Rice Terrace.

Our cottage had a high, four-poster bed, a large LCD TV hidden within a multi-purpose unit, writing desk, wardrobe with self-sensing light and a luxurious bath-tub and entrance to the outdoor shower in the bathroom. Yes, we had a completely private outdoor shower adjoining the cottage pool, both of which were surrounded by thick, protective foliage. But the fixture we ended up using the most was the comfy, long settee outside the cottage, perfect for listening to the birds and bees and dozing the afternoon away.

The day we arrived, we kept up our exploration of Maya Ubud s infinity pools, walking trails and hidden sanctuaries well until darkness took over. We raced against time to make it across the wooden bridge over the robust Petanu River, close to the spa and the riverside restaurant. We felt like we were in a rainforest, surrounded by lush greenery and the soothing gush of the waterfall. Another favourite moment was when we climbed a large mound in the middle of the resort garden so we could be silhouetted against the setting sun. We also toured the prestigious Petanu Villa and observed red and orange fish swimming around in the L-shaped pond between the gym and golf course.

Our second day at Maya Ubud began with a rejuvenating couples Balinese full-body massage. We were given a choice of three different oils jasmine oil, ginger oil and a traditional Balinese flower oil with curative properties. We ve enjoyed several Balinese massages in India but to experience the real thing in Bali was a revelation. We wished we could learn to massage the soles of our feet the way the therapists did!
